Output 6608877488fa71a0f14735965ad4fe48b22279f786829de50581b102ac38de81:4

value
10695
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 53bb855019a506c13cd7d12a9a4f43be125ed52a251152ff3ea34ec6aad930e6
address
ltc1p2wac25qe55rvz0xh6y4f5n6rhcf9a4f2y5g49le75d8vd2kexrnqz5y60z
transaction
6608877488fa71a0f14735965ad4fe48b22279f786829de50581b102ac38de81
spent
true